The Importance of Cyber Security Mentorship

In today's digital age, cyber security is more important than ever. As technology continues to advance, so do the threats and risks associated with it. This is where cyber security mentorship programs come into play. These programs provide valuable guidance and support to individuals who are interested in pursuing a career in cyber security or are already working in the field. The Cs,Sensei cyber security mentorship program is one such program that offers webinars and training Sessions to help mentees enhance their skills and knowledge.

The Role of Ethics in Cyber Security

Ethics play a crucial role in the field of cyber security. The Cs,Sensei cyber security mentorship program emphasizes the importance of ethical behavior and encourages mentees to always prioritize what is right over what is expedient. This includes following established procedures, admitting mistakes, and maintaining a high ethical standard. Mentees can learn from real-life examples and discuss ethical challenges they may face in their work.

The Need for Written Procedures and SOPs

Effective cyber security practices rely on well-documented written procedures and standard operating procedures (SOPs). In the Cs,Sensei cyber security mentorship program, mentees are encouraged to develop and share SOPs for common cyber security tasks. This not only helps mentees Create a sense of structure and organization in their work but also enables them to contribute to the overall improvement of cyber security processes.

USAJobs and Tech.usajobs.gov for Cyber Security Careers

Finding employment in the cyber security field can be a challenge. The Cs,Sensei cyber security mentorship program introduces mentees to resources like USAJobs and tech.usajobs.gov that provide listings of tech and cyber security jobs. Mentees are encouraged to explore these platforms and take advantage of the opportunities available.
